Are you familiar with the basics of photography and want to learn more about handling your camera and composing better images? Do you want to better understand the concept of photographic series and the power of visual storytelling?

The Beirut Center of Photography in collaboration with Artnub Beirut is launching it’s Intermediate Photography Course aimed to get you to operate with photography skill, knowledge, and experience at an intermediary level.

This course is of great interest to all learners who would like to go beyond the automatic setting on their camera. Having studied this course you will be more confident in taking manual control of the camera and adjusting the shutter speed, ISO and aperture to get the correct exposure for your photographs.

Our training program is made up of a three-part format which includes theory, application, and review/critique. The 5 sessions are a mixture of indoor and outdoor learning experience. Every session is split into 2 parts.

1- A practical or technical approach to photography.
2- Lectures and discussions on visual storytelling with established photographers that work in diverse fields.

At the beginning of the course, students will have the opportunity to choose the topic that they want to work on. These projects will be screened and discussed.

Course Program

June 24
Session 1: Using Natural Light

– The Basics of Photography (A refresher)
– Working with natural light
– Controlling natural light
-Talk by Patrick Baz

July 1
Session 2: Low Light Photography

– The role of white balance in photography
– Working with low light
– Understanding ISO
– Tips and tricks used in low light photography (no equipment needed)
– Talk on Photography and Therapy with Maya Alameddine

July 8
Session 3: Light Meter, Light Conditions, and Using Flash

– Using the built-in camera light meter
– Understanding the difference between Matrix, center weight, and spot.
– Working with different natural lighting conditions
– An introduction to mixed light photography
– Talk on wildlife photography by Michel Zoghzoghi

July 15
Session 4: Improving Skills

– Applying newly learned skills while shooting close up portraits and people.
– The floor is open to discussion of questions that students might have about what they have learned throughout the course
– Talk on scientific photography by Gaby Maamary

July 20
Session 5: Review/Critique

This will be an all-day session, where all student projects are collected, screened, and discussed both in terms of technical and visual aspects, with a focus on the power of visual storytelling and the importance of working on series.
